Hiking Trail Conditions Report
Peaks
Peaks Carr Mountain, NH
Trails
Trails: Three Ponds Trail, Carr Mountain Trail
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Saturday, September 11, 2021
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: Smooth, level, gravel lot could hold up to about 10-12 cars. I was the 6th car @ 10am. At 1:30pm 3 new cars had arrived & 3 existing cars had left. 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Dry Trail, Wet Trail, Wet/Slippery Rock, Standing/Running Water on Trail, Mud - Minor/Avoidable, Mud - Significant 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ment:  
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: Over a dozen and a half crossings mostly ranging from trickling mud beds to small step overs. One more significant but not too difficult crossing at the beginning requires careful footing on the slippery rocks. 
Trail Maintenance Notes
Trail Maintenance Notes: There are 2 blow downs. The first is just before 1750' and consists of the top branches of part of a large tree. The second is just before 2350' and is a single rotten trunk. Neither completely block the trail. 
Dog-Related Notes
Dog-Related Notes:  
Bugs
Bugs: There were some but they never bothered with me. 
Lost and Found
Lost and Found:  
 
Comments
Comments: Most of the trail was in decent shape except for some large mud areas near the top. A couple limited but decent views between the trees from atop the fire tower footings. Saw 6 people and one dog.
